相关文章

神经网络系列---权重初始化方法

文章目录 权重初始化方法Xavier初始化(Xavier initialization)Kaiming初始化,也称为He初始化LeCun 初始化正态分布与均匀分布Orthogonal InitializationSparse Initializationn_in和n_out代码实现 权重初始化方法 Xavier初始化(X…

基于FPGA实现CIC升采样滤波器verilog HDL代码总结

基于FPGA实现CIC升采样滤波器verilog HDL代码总结 一、概述二、设计说明三、代码实现1、顶层代码2、产生正弦信号代码(调用了xilinx RAM IP)3、CIC升采样滤波实现代码 四、仿真结果 一、概述 上文中我们总结了CIC基本原理设计,本文将基于xil…

CIC详细设计说明文档

1.1 CIC基本理论分析 CIC滤波器是一种基于零极点相抵消的FIR滤波器。N级CIC抽取滤波器的基本结构框图如图1所示。 图1 CIC基本结构 由图1可知,它由积分器( Integrator)、抽取器(Decimation)和梳状滤波器(CombFilte)三部分组成。 因此在实际的设计过程中,一个CIC滤波器的基本…

matlab cic插值与抽取,CIC抽取滤波器和插值滤波器

一、CIC抽取滤波器 r 2; %抽取因子 hm mfilt.cicdecim(r); fs 44.1e3; %原始信号采样频率44.1khz n 1:10239; % 10240个采样点 x sin(2*pi*1e3/fs*n); %原始信号 y_fi filter(hm,x); % 得到抽取的5120个采样点 xdouble(x); ydo…

基于matlab的CIC滤波器仿真

1.1 MATLAB设计说明 这个CIC滤波器的频率特性,如果上图,上图和梳子比较相似。所以称为梳状滤波器。 这个是CIC抽取滤波器,如图可以看到,每2个点抽取一个点,达到抽取效果。 这个是CIC内插滤波器,如图可以看到…

CIC-IDS2017数据集训练和测试

1、数据集预处理 1.1 整合数据并剔除脏数据 如上图所示,整个数据集是分开的,想要训练,必须要整合在一起,同时在数据集中存在 Nan 和 Infiniti 脏数据(只有第 15 列和第 16 列存在)需要剔除: 具…

CIC滤波器的设计与仿真

CIC滤波器已经被证明是在高速抽取和插值系统中非常有效的单元,具有结构简单,易于工程实现的特点。CIC滤波器是数据通讯中的常用模块,一般用于数字下变频(DDC)和数字上变频(DUC)系统,随着数据传输率的增加,级联梳状滤波器(CIC)的应…

m基于FPGA和MATLAB的数字CIC滤波器设计和实现

目录 1.算法概述 2.仿真效果预览 3.MATLAB/FPGA部分代码预览 4.完整MATLAB/FPGA程序 1.算法概述 CIC滤波器由一对或多对积分-梳状滤波器组成,在抽取CIC中,输入信号依次经过积分,降采样,以及与积分环节数目相同的梳状滤波器。在…

【CIC滤波器】基于MATLAB/FPGA的数字CIC滤波器的设计

FPGA代码: module down(i_clk,//输入时钟i_rst,//输入复位信号i_M, //抽取值i_data,//输入信号o_data,//输出信号r_clk);input i_clk;//输入时钟 input i_rst;//输入复位信号 input [7:0] i_M; //抽取值 input signe…

matlab 级联cic,Matlab中CIC滤波器的应用

CIC滤波器基本原理 CIC(积分梳状级联)滤波器是工程上经常用的滤波器,因为CIC滤波器不需要乘法,CIC滤波器往往在级联抽取滤波器的第一级和级联插值滤波器的最后一级。这一节我们以CIC抽取滤波器为例来讲CIC滤波器的使用方法,CIC滤波器的数学模式为: image-20201002173656346…

使用wget下载CIC Dataset

文章目录 数据集地址安装wget命令解析References 数据集地址 数据集主页: https://www.unb.ca/cic/datasets/iotdataset-2022.html 数据集下载地址: Index of /IOTDataset/CIC_IOT_Dataset2022/CICIOT 安装wget 该工具Linux自带 Windows要用的话&…

Matlab中CIC滤波器的应用

Matlab中CIC滤波器的应用 CIC滤波器基本原理 CIC(积分梳状级联)滤波器是工程上经常用的滤波器,因为CIC滤波器不需要乘法,CIC滤波器往往在级联抽取滤波器的第一级和级联插值滤波器的最后一级。这一节我们以CIC抽取滤波器为例来讲C…

CIC梳状滤波器

简介 CIC (Cascade-Integrator-Comb)级联梳状滤波器经常用于定点的差值与抽取过程中。此滤波器的参数均为1,没有乘法器。CIC 插值 如上图 a b c 均为M(M位整数)插值器,他们有相同的脉冲响应 4阶 40插值器实现---matlab实现 M= 40; % interpolation ratio Nstages= 4; % num…

matlab cic设计,CIC滤波器设计

CIC滤波器实现简单,资源消耗少(只需要加法器),成为变采样率系统中比较常用的滤波器,但也需要在合适的场景中使用,不然对信号质量会造成较大影响。 我们可以通过matlab的filter designer了解CIC滤波器的各种特性。通过图1和图2找到CIC滤波器设计窗口。 图1 图2 从幅频曲线中…

cic matlab,Matlab中CIC滤波器的应用

CIC滤波器基本原理 CIC(积分梳状级联)滤波器是工程上经常用的滤波器,因为CIC滤波器不需要乘法,CIC滤波器往往在级联抽取滤波器的第一级和级联插值滤波器的最后一级。这一节我们以CIC抽取滤波器为例来讲CIC滤波器的使用方法,CIC滤波器的数学模…

FPGA数字信号处理(十八)Quartus CIC IP核实现

该篇是FPGA数字信号处理的第18篇,题接上篇,本文详细介绍使用Quartus自带的CIC IP核进行设计的方法。下一篇会介绍使用Vivado的IP核设计CIC的方法。 IP核概述 由于版本的关系,Quartus提供的IP核有两种,一种是集成在“MegaWizard P…

m基于FPGA的积分梳状CIC滤波器verilog设计

目录 1.算法描述 2.仿真效果预览 3.verilog核心程序 4.完整FPGA 1.算法描述 积分梳状滤波器,是指该滤波器的冲激响应具有如下形式: 其物理框图如图所示: 可见,CIC滤波器是由两部分组成:累积器H1和H2梳状滤波器的级…

FPGA数字信号处理(十九)Vivado CIC IP核实现

该篇是FPGA数字信号处理的第19篇,题接上篇,本文详细介绍使用Vivado自带的CIC IP核进行设计的方法。关于单级CIC滤波器、多级CIC滤波器的Verilog HDL设计以及Quartus中CIC IP核的使用方法可以参考前面的文章。 IP核概述 Xilinx的CIC IP核属于收费IP&#…

CIC梳妆滤波器matlab仿真

目录 1.算法仿真效果 2.MATLAB源码 3.算法概述 4.部分参考文献 1.算法仿真效果 matlab2022a仿真结果如下: 2.MATLAB源码 %***************************************************************************

FPGA数字信号处理(十六)单级CIC滤波器Verilog设计

该篇是FPGA数字信号处理的第16篇,选题为多速率信号处理系统中常用的CIC滤波器。本文将详细介绍使用Verilog HDL设计单级CIC滤波器的方法。接下来几篇会介绍多级CIC滤波器的Verilog设计、使用Quartus和Vivado的IP核设计CIC的方法。 多速率信号处理的相关知识可以参考…